Перед началом работы
Данное руководство создано для разработчиков, которые хотят использовать XSLT для преобразования XML-данных в другие формы без необходимости программирования на Java™ или других языках.
В данном руководстве подразумевается, что вы знакомы с XML, однако автор не вдается в какие-то тайные особенности этого языка, поэтому базового понимания вполне достаточно. За исключением небольшого раздела про расширения, вам не нужно иметь за плечами никакого особенного языка программирования. И даже в этом разделе идеи очень просты и применимы к любому языку программирования, который поддерживается процессором.
Это руководство - о преобразованиях расширяемого языка таблиц стилей (XSLT). XSLT - это одна из базовых спецификаций, связанных с XML, позволяющая легко переводить XML-данные из одной формы в другую.
В данном руководстве вы изучите:
- Основы XSLT
- Использование простых шаблонов
- Публикацию данных
- Управление пробелами
- Основы XPath
- Функции XPath
- Циклы и условные операторы
- Импорт и включение других таблиц стилей
- Расширение XSLT
- Переменные XSLT